 GOLDEN SECTION SEARCH METHOD (CHAPTER 09.01)

 

Example : Part 2 of 2

 

By Duc Nguyen



TOPIC DESCRIPTION
 
Learn the Golden Search Method via example. Find the angle which will maximize the cross-sectional area of the a gutter (part 2 of 2).
